Ford Australia today announced that following strong demand for the all-new Mustang an extra 2,000 will be heading to Australian shores. At the same time they’ve added new colours, and new in-car technology to please 2017 owners.
The new shipment will arrive toward the end of 2016 with Model Year 2017 (MY17) vehicles set to be packed with the latest in-car infotainment system from Ford – Sync 3.
Sync 3 is a big win for owners, as it offers Apple CarPlay, Android Auto and Ford Applink 3.0 as well as increased functionality and better responsiveness.
1,500 more orders were placed for the Mustang than Ford Australia had expected, creating an “Instant Sales Halo” for the Ford lineup.
To diversify the range on the road, there will also be three new colours in that shipment, with Lightning Blue, Grabber Blue and White Platinum Tri-Coat joining the current mix – though we’d have to expect it unlikely they beat the most popular colour in Australia – Race Red.
40% of Aussie Mustangs sold in February are sold with the EcoBoost engine, justifying that implementation for Ford globally and Ford Australia.
The queue is long, but unlike a Tesla Model 3, you won’t have to wait years for your Ford Mustang.
